Policy Points
Wellness has grown into a multi-trillion-dollar industry encompassing a multitude of products and practices that affect health and well-being.
Applying a lens of commercial determin...
The wellness industry can help to promote healthy living, but it can also be at odds with the population-level interventions of public health.
